Here is the full schedule of Pokemon GO events happening in March 2023:
- Catch Mastery: March 5
- Festival of Colors: March 8-14
- Elite Raid: March 11
- March 2023 Community Day: March 18
- Let’s GO! + Team GO Rocket Takeover: March 21-29
- GO Battle Day: Palmer: March 25
In addition to these large events, there are also weekly Spotlight Hours for March 2023, as well as five Legendary Raid Hours this month!

Catch Mastery – March 5
The first Pokemon GO event of March 2023 is Catch Mastery. This one-day event is taking place on March 2023 and features Hitmontop, Hitmonchan, and Hitmonlee.
This event will also feature Timed Research which requires getting nice, great, and excellent throws!

Festival of Colors – March 8-14
The Festival of Colors event is returning to Pokemon GO in March 2023.
Niantic has not announced what is in store for this year’s festival, but last year saw all of the different colors of Oricorio make their debut in Pokemon GO. Let’s hope for another bright addition to the Pokedex this time too!

Elite Raid – March 11
Elite Raids are returning to Pokemon GO for the first time this year in March 2023, and there will be two new Raid bosses to battle!
The new Elite Raids on March 11 will feature Regidrago and Regieleki. This will be the first time players can catch these new Legendaries in Pokemon GO!

The March 2023 Pokemon GO Community Day features Slowpoke as well as its Galarian regional variant.
It is taking place on March 18, so make sure to add the date to your diary if you’re in need of Slowpoke Candy or want to catch a shiny Slowpoke!

Let’s GO! + Team GO Rocket Takeover – March 21-29
Niantic has not revealed anything about the Let’s GO event in Pokemon GO yet, however, judging by its name, we expect it’ll feature Meltan!
Team GO Rocket will also be making a return during this event, so be ready for a battle!

GO Battle Day: Palmer – March 25
On March 25, 2023, the GO Battle Day: Palmer will let Pokemon trainers compete in the GO Battle League for exclusive rewards.
There will be a Timed Research that will reward players with gloves inspired by Palmer from Pokemon Diamond and Pearl.
